The Significance of MCP Middleware
Middleware serves as a crucial bridge between software applications, enabling them to interact and share data effectively. MCP middleware, specifically, is designed to simplify the complexity of integrating AI agents with a myriad of data sources and tools. This section outlines the significance of MCP middleware in modern operations, including:
- Improved Efficiency: Streamlining processes by reducing the time and resources required for data integration.
- Enhanced Collaboration: Facilitating better communication between different systems and departments.
- Scalability: Enabling businesses to expand their operations without compromising performance.

1. What is MCP Middleware, and how does it differ from traditional middleware?
MCP Middleware is a specialized form of middleware designed to facilitate seamless communication between AI agents and diverse data sources. Unlike traditional middleware, which primarily focuses on application integration, MCP middleware places a stronger emphasis on AI integration and real-time data processing.
2. Can MCP Middleware be used in any industry?
Yes, MCP middleware can be used in any industry that requires efficient data integration and AI-powered operations. Its versatility makes it an invaluable asset for businesses across various sectors, including retail, healthcare, finance, and more.
3. How does MCP Middleware enhance collaboration within an organization?
MCP middleware enhances collaboration by providing a centralized platform for data sharing and communication. This allows different departments and teams to access and share information in real-time, fostering better collaboration and decision-making.
